Sat 758045470658180

decimal
151609.470658180
degree
0°151609′409″470658180‴
percentile
36.0974034043824%
name
imdcxygxcgz
cycle
0
epoch
0
period
75
block
151609
offset
470658180
timestamp
rarity
common